about

BLEACHED CROSS return with “Wrath”, a towering and emotionally devastating full-length that pushes the band’s blackened post-punk sound into darker and more cinematic territory than ever before. Across ten tracks, the Chicago band explores grief, loss, death, and redemption through crushing atmosphere, industrialized tension, and massive melodic hooks - all while balancing oppressive heaviness with moments of genuine vulnerability and catharsis.

Recorded with Andy Nelson at Bricktop Recording in Chicago, “Wrath” was built with an obsessive focus on mood, pacing, and sound design, often creating intensity through noise, texture, and negative space rather than sheer force alone. The result is a record that feels immersive and haunted, pulling equally from darkwave, industrial music, post-punk, and extreme music while remaining deeply rooted in emotional storytelling.

Following several releases and shows alongside artists like Frail Body, Secret Shame, Black Magnet, and Cloakroom, BLEACHED CROSS deliver their most focused and fully realized statement yet: a mournful, cinematic descent into personal hell that ultimately searches for healing in the shadow of loss.
